which statement describes mechanical energy? the energy that is associated with temperature the energy that is stored in chemical bonds the sum of the kinetic energy and the potential energy of an object the type of energy that is associated with electromagnetic radiation
Answer
Brief Explanations:
Mechanical energy is defined as the sum of an object's kinetic energy (energy of motion) and potential energy (stored energy due to position or state). Energy associated with temperature is thermal energy, energy stored in chemical bonds is chemical energy, and energy associated with electromagnetic radiation is electromagnetic energy.
Answer:
the sum of the kinetic energy and the potential energy of an object
